Family / Youth Shelter — low-barrier youth emergency shelter
low-barrier youth emergency shelter. Serves Runaway, homeless, couch-surfing, or housing-unstable youth. Gender/access: All genders. Age: Ages 10-17. Household eligibility: Individual youth; guardian is contacted on arrival. Intake: Youth may contact the shelter directly; Safe Place sites connect youth to shelter staff within 30 minutes. Eligibility: Youth ages 10-17 experiencing homelessness, running away, couch surfing, a gap in housing, or immediate risk of those conditions. Accessibility: Call to discuss individual accessibility needs. Published capacity: 6 emergency shelter beds. Waitlist/availability: Call any time for current availability and safety planning. Meals: Food is provided; exact meal schedule not published. Showers: Private bedrooms and residential amenities; exact shower policy not published. Case management: Individual plan of care, counseling connections, and family mediation. Housing navigation: Discharge planning and housing assistance. Mental-health services: Counseling connections and crisis support. Transportation: Shelter or Youth Center transportation may be available depending on staffing.
